GUY-WIRE
Definitions of GUY-WIRE
- A metal guy rope used to stabilize a tall structure (such as a radio mast).

Examples of Using GUY-WIRE in a Sentence
- The tension in the diagonal guy-wire, combined with the compression and buckling strength of the structure, allows the structure to withstand lateral loads such as wind or the weight of cantilevered structures.
- The lightsaber hum, for instance, was derived from a film projector idling combined with feedback from a broken television set, and the blaster effect started with the sound acquired from hitting a guy-wire on a radio tower with a hammer.
